Mini serving dishes are small-scale tableware typically used for serving appetizers, snacks, or small portions of food. They come in various styles, designs, and materials, catering to different culinary and aesthetic needs. Here are some key points about mini serving dishes:
Types:
Mini serving dishes come in various types, each serving a different purpose. Miniature cast iron skillet dishes, such as tiny skillets and dutch ovens, are perfect for serving hot appetizers and small portions. Similarly, ramekins are versatile mini serving dishes used for sauces, dips, desserts, and baking. On the other hand, slates and boards provide a rustic and elegant platform for presenting charcuterie boards, cheese platters, and appetizers. They allow for creative arrangement and easy sharing. Additionally, shot glasses have found a playful and trendy use in serving shots, desserts, and layered presentations, adding a fun element to the dining experience.
Materials:
Mini serving dishes are made from a variety of materials to suit different preferences and occasions. Glass mini serving dishes offer transparency and elegance, showcasing the food inside. Metal options provide durability and a modern touch, while ceramic dishes bring warmth and versatility to the table. Wood serving dishes provide a natural and rustic appeal, and plastic dishes cater to convenience and affordability, especially for outdoor or casual settings.
Purpose:
Mini serving dishes add a touch of elegance and sophistication to the dining experience. They allow for the presentation of food in a visually appealing manner, making it easier to showcase and highlight dishes. They also promote portion control, ensuring that small, controlled amounts of food are served at a time. This is particularly useful for tapas-style dining or when serving specialty dishes that are meant to be savored in smaller quantities. Moreover, mini serving dishes are great for sharing, encouraging a communal dining experience where guests can try different appetizers or small plates.
A plethora of mini serving dishes are available in the market, each with unique design attributes that render them suitable for particular culinary and serving requirements. The assortment of designs ranges from traditional to contemporary, allowing for personalized style preferences.
Standard dishes
Standard mini serving dishes are small bowls and plates; they can be made of different materials such as glass, wood, or metal. These dishes are simple and can be used for various purposes. They come in different sizes and shapes, like round, square, or oval, so they can easily fit into any style or theme.
Tiered trays
Tiered trays have several levels stacked on top of each other. Each level has its own space for serving food. Tiered trays are usually made of metal or ceramic and have fancy designs along the edges. They allow people to see all the different dishes at once and save room by going up instead of out.
Mini cast iron skillets
Mini cast iron skillets look like tiny versions of regular frying pans. They are strong, last long, and keep heat well. Mini cast iron skillets make it possible to cook some foods right at the table, such as mini frittatas, mac n cheese, and sizzling dips. They have long handles that make it easy to grab and move around. These skillets often have a rustic, old-fashioned appearance that adds charm to mealtimes.
Miniature food trucks
Miniature food trucks are small models of real food trucks. These serving dishes look like food trucks and bring a fun touch to the table. People can use them to serve snacks, appetizers, or desserts. Mini food trucks are usually made of metal or ceramic and come in different colors and styles. They make it look like food is being served from a food truck, making meals more exciting and enjoyable.
Miniature cloches
Cloches are glass domes used in gardens to protect young plants from bad weather. Miniature cloches serving dishes are small versions of these domes. They are used to cover and showcase food on tables. Mini cloches can make dishes look fancy by covering them with a glass dome. They are usually made of glass with metal handles and come in various sizes to fit different plates and bowls.
Mini serving dishes are versatile and can be used in different settings ranging from home to commercial. They are good at what they do – adding charm, elegance, and practicality to serving food. In a home setting, mini serving dishes can be used during meals or special occasions. During everyday meals, they can be incorporated into the breakfast, lunch, or dinner spread. For instance, one can use them to serve condiments like ketchup, mustard, or barbecue sauce alongside fried foods. They are great for serving pickles, olives, or cheese when serving snacks or drinks in the evening. They can also be used to present a variety of dips like hummus, salsa, or ranch dressing with chips or vegetables.
Special occasions such as birthday parties, anniversaries, or holiday dinners often require more than just the usual menu. Mini serving dishes come in handy when one wants to add a unique touch to their presentation. They can be used as individual appetizer plates where each guest gets one for themselves. Alternatively, they could be used as sauce pots placed on each table so guests can serve themselves. Another home use of these dishes is in buffets. Mini serving dishes help organize different food items, making it easy for guests to choose what they want.
Commercial establishments such as restaurants, hotels, and catering services also have numerous applications for mini serving dishes. In fine dining restaurants that have multiple courses, small serving dishes may be used for starters or desserts. Caterers can use them to create visually appealing displays at events. Hotels can place them in rooms as part of welcome trays offering snacks like nuts or dried fruit.
Mini serving dishes find great use in bars and pubs too. They can be used to serve bar snacks like peanuts, popcorn, or nachos. They can also be used to present a variety of sauces and dips with finger foods. Moreover, they are ideal for brunches or high tea services where small portions are served.
Mini serving dishes are also popular in catering and event planning. They are used to present food at weddings, conferences, and parties. They add a touch of sophistication to the event and make it easy for guests to enjoy the food.
